What is a CMMS? A CMMS, also known as a computerized maintenance management system, is a software tool designed to simplify and automate maintenance management tasks. It provides a centralized platform for managing maintenance activities, work orders, inventory, and asset information.
Importance of implementing a CMMS Implementing a CMMS can have a significant impact on an organization's maintenance operations. It enables better planning, scheduling, and tracking of maintenance tasks, leading to improved equipment reliability, increased productivity, and cost savings.
Benefits of Implementing a CMMS
Improved maintenance planning and scheduling A CMMS helps organizations streamline maintenance planning and scheduling processes. It allows maintenance teams to schedule preventive maintenance tasks, allocate resources efficiently, and minimize downtime by ensuring timely maintenance activities.
Increased equipment reliability and uptime By implementing a CMMS, organizations can improve equipment reliability and minimize unexpected breakdowns. The system enables proactive maintenance by scheduling preventive maintenance tasks based on equipment usage and performance data.
Enhanced asset management CMMS software provides comprehensive asset management capabilities. It allows organizations to track and manage assets throughout their lifecycle, including procurement, maintenance history, depreciation, and retirement.
Efficient inventory management With a CMMS, organizations can effectively manage their inventory of spare parts and supplies. The system keeps track of inventory levels, generates automatic reorder notifications, and ensures the availability of necessary items for maintenance tasks.
Streamlined work order management CMMS software simplifies work order management by automating the creation, assignment, and tracking of work orders. It provides a centralized system to manage work requests, prioritize tasks, and monitor their progress in real-time.
Improved data collection and analysis A CMMS enables organizations to collect and analyze maintenance-related data. It helps identify trends, performance patterns, and areas for improvement. This data-driven approach allows organizations to make informed decisions and optimize maintenance strategies.
Effective preventive maintenance Preventive maintenance is crucial for minimizing equipment failures and maximizing asset lifespan. A CMMS facilitates the planning and execution of preventive maintenance tasks, ensuring equipment is serviced at regular intervals based on manufacturer recommendations.
Cost savings and ROI Implementing a CMMS can lead to significant cost savings in maintenance operations. By reducing equipment downtime, improving resource utilization, and optimizing inventory management, organizations can achieve a higher return on investment (ROI) in their maintenance activities.
Compliance and regulatory requirements Many industries have specific regulatory requirements for maintenance and safety. A CMMS helps organizations stay compliant by providing documentation, tracking maintenance activities, and generating reports for audits and inspections.
